Pain management after dental implant surgery is a vital facet of the recovery course of that can considerably influence a patient’s overall expertise and satisfaction. Dental implants involve a surgical procedure, which naturally brings about discomfort and potential pain in the days following the operation. Understanding the means to successfully manage this pain is important for a smoother recovery.
Immediately after the surgery, it is common for patients to feel some extent of soreness, swelling, and bruising around the implant website. This discomfort can vary from delicate to reasonable, and it may be managed effectively with a big selection of strategies. The dental professional will typically prescribe pain relief treatment that may help mitigate these sensations. Over-the-counter pain relievers like ibuprofen or acetaminophen may additionally be really helpful for house use.


In addition to medicine, making use of ice packs to the affected space can be useful. This may help in lowering each swelling and pain within the quick aftermath of the surgery. Patients are usually suggested to use ice for intervals of 15-20 minutes at a time, allowing for breaks in between functions to keep away from skin harm. It's essential to ensure the ice pack is not utilized on to the skin; wrapping it in a material is advisable.


Eating gentle meals following dental implant surgery is important for minimizing discomfort. Hard or crunchy meals could worsen the surgical web site and increase pain levels. Foods such as yogurt, apple sauce, and mashed potatoes are glorious options in the course of the preliminary recovery period. Maintaining a nutritional balance whereas avoiding irritation to the implant website can assist in healing and support total health.

After the primary few days, the depth of pain generally begins to lower, however some patients may still expertise discomfort. Following the post-operative directions provided by the dental care group is important. This includes medication schedules, activity restrictions, and hygiene practices designed to facilitate healing and cut back the chance of problems.


Rest performs a major function in pain management after dental implant surgery. Patients are inspired to keep away from strenuous actions and heavy lifting within the days following the process. Adequate relaxation permits the body to focus its vitality on therapeutic, finally serving to to reduce pain and discomfort.


Maintaining correct oral hygiene is one other important think about pain management. Although it could be uncomfortable initially, gently rinsing with warm salt water can assist in keeping the surgical website clean. This apply not solely aids in reducing the chance of infection but also promotes healing, which can help manage pain ranges successfully.

In some instances, sufferers might experience higher levels of tension or stress related to the pain and recovery process. Managing emotional well-being is simply as necessary as physical care. Engaging in mindfulness techniques, meditation, or breathing exercises can be beneficial. These practices might help patients really feel extra in charge of their recovery, doubtlessly reducing the notion of pain.


If pain persists past what is expected or worsens over time, it's critical to contact the dental care provider. Complications corresponding to infection or improper therapeutic would possibly require extra intervention. Being proactive about communicating any considerations with pain ranges can facilitate timely responses and modifications to the treatment plan.

    What should I expect by means of pain after dental implant surgery?undefinedAfter dental implant surgery, some discomfort and delicate to moderate pain are regular. This often peaks inside the first 24-48 hours and then steadily diminishes. Pain can typically be managed with over-the-counter medications as really helpful by your dentist.

How can I manage pain after the surgery?undefinedPain could be managed via prescribed pain medications or over-the-counter NSAIDs like ibuprofen. Additionally, making use of ice packs to the realm for the primary 24 hours might help reduce swelling and discomfort.


Is it regular to have swelling after dental implant surgery?undefinedYes, swelling is a standard side impact after dental implant surgery and might contribute to discomfort. The swelling sometimes peaks inside 2-3 days after which subsides. Ice applications during the first day can decrease swelling.

When ought to I contact my dentist about pain?undefinedIf you experience extreme pain that isn’t relieved with prescribed medications or if the pain worsens after the initial surgery interval, it’s important to contact your dentist. This might point out an underlying issue like infection.

Are there any dietary restrictions that may affect pain management?undefinedYes, it's advisable to keep away from hard, spicy, or scorching meals proper after surgery. Sticking to softer meals can help prevent irritation and discomfort, permitting the therapeutic process to proceed more easily.


What role do antibiotics play in pain management post-surgery?undefinedAntibiotics are prescribed to stop infection, which might trigger pain and issues. Taking them as directed can reduce the danger of secondary infections that may lead to elevated discomfort.


How long will I must take pain treatment after the surgery?undefinedPain medicine usage varies by individual but is often really helpful for the first 3-5 days post-surgery. Always comply with your dentist's steering concerning the click to investigate duration and dosage of medicine.


Is there something I ought to keep away from to help with pain management?undefinedYes, avoid smoking, strenuous exercise, and actions that stress the jaw, as these can hinder the therapeutic course of and increase pain. Keeping your head elevated while resting also can assist in lowering discomfort.

Will using a heat compress assist with pain management?undefinedAfter the primary 24 hours, transitioning to warm compresses can help soothe discomfort, improve blood circulate, and promote therapeutic. Be certain to alternate with cold compresses initially for optimum outcomes.
